A big storm called Byron came to Cyprus last weekend. It rained a lot on the island. The rain was good for water. But it also made floods, especially in Paphos. The storm was strong from Friday to Monday. The government gave a yellow warning.
The rain helped Cyprus after a dry time. It added water to the big water places. This is the most water this year. The water is good for farmers and nature. A waterfall started to flow again.
But the rain also made problems. Polis Chrysochous had big floods. Water went into houses. A main road closed. Workers cleaned the roads.
The mayor of Polis Chrysochous said things are better. Teams worked hard. But they are still working.
Dirty water went into the sea. This could hurt sea animals. The yellow warning stayed for some days. More rain and wind were coming.
Storm Byron gave water. But it also showed Cyprus needs to be ready for bad weather.
